Activities - how the charity spends its money
The objects of the charitable company are the advancement for the public benefit through the provision and maintenance of churches and public chapels in connection with any institutions for the time being under the control of the Congregation, through the relief of poor persons and through provision of convents and houses of residence for members of the Congregation.
